The blog

How affiliate platforms will revolutionize marketing strategy in 2025

stratégie marketing en 2025 - affiliation marketing

Would you like to start an affiliate program to boost sales and increase awareness of your e-commerce business? In 2025, affiliation platforms are redefining business strategies. These innovative solutions not only automate complex processes, but also maximize revenues through targeted, high-performance partnerships. To remain competitive in a constantly evolving environment, adopting these tools is becoming a strategic necessity. Here, Casaneo explains how to integrate these platforms into your marketing strategy for 2025.

Optimize your sales strategy with Casaneo, your affiliation ally!

Understanding how affiliation platforms work

Before creating an affiliate program, you need to understand how affiliate platforms work. As their name suggests, these are specialized affiliate sites that enable companies of all sizes to collaborate with affiliate partners (bloggers, influencers, etc.). Their mission is to promote their products or services via affiliate links or banners, in exchange for a commission on sales generated by their efforts.

These platforms offer a dedicated space for :

  • Manage affiliate programs
  • Monitor the performance of each affiliate partner
  • Ensure payment of commissions.

Thanks to specialized sites such as Awin, Amazon, Rakuten and Casaneo, e-merchants can access new growth opportunities. These tools help to diversify traffic sources. They also help brands build loyalty among demanding customers, while reducing traditional advertising costs.

Brands and e-tailers can now rely on motivated new affiliates to recommend products, expand their audience and increase sales, all with simplified payment and program management.

The strategic advantages of affiliate platforms in 2025

It goes without saying that, in 2025, affiliate marketing platforms are becoming an essential lever for companies wishing to maximize their marketing performance while optimizing their costs. Thanks to increasingly sophisticated affiliate programs, brands benefit from a strategy focused on sales, customer satisfaction and greater online visibility.

Here’s why these tools are game-changers.

Reducing costs and expanding brand presence

By adopting an affiliate marketing platform, you can replace costly advertising campaigns with targeted collaborations with affiliates. This model is based on pay-for-performance. This ensures that you’re only paid for the results you achieve(clicks, conversion rates or sales). By adopting a performance platform, your e-commerce business can increase sales by up to 35% and reduce advertising costs by 20%.

The impact of emerging technologies on affiliate programs

Technological advances are gradually transforming affiliate programs. Artificial intelligence (AI) and automation :

  • Simplify affiliate network management
  • Facilitate performance analysis
  • Optimize commission strategies.

Modern platforms like Casaneo use algorithms to allocate sales credits more fairly between partners. This improves transparency and loyalty within programs.

Network expansion and penetration of new markets

Affiliate marketing platforms don’t just optimize costs. They also offer unique opportunities to expand your network and penetrate new markets. Affiliate marketing broadens the horizons of online stores. They can now reach customers in previously inaccessible regions.

An adaptable, scalable strategy

Affiliate marketing sites also offer great flexibility. You can adjust your campaigns according to performance and market trends. This adaptability is essential in a constantly changing environment.

Discover our solutions on Casaneo and turn your objectives into measurable successes.

Preparing your e-commerce site for affiliation: essential prerequisites

Clearly, affiliate marketing offers online site owners unique opportunities to reach new customers and earn money. Adopting an affiliate strategy, however, requires rigorous preparation to guarantee performance and lasting results. Here are the prerequisites for success in this competitive field.

Essential tools and resources

Choosing the right platform is a crucial step. For optimal supervision of your affiliate program, the platform must have :

  • High-performance tools such as payment trackers
  • Dashboards to track conversions
  • Commission management systems.

To simplify the process, also invest in resources such as affiliate guides, affiliate network management solutions, and integrations with marketing software.

Develop a clear marketing strategy

A well-defined strategy is the key to success in affiliate marketing. Define precise objectives: generate traffic, increase brand awareness, generate sales or improve return on investment.

Identify your flagship products and potential partners. Make sure you work with affiliates aligned with your brand values.

To motivate affiliates to promote your offers, rely on transparent communication and attractive incentives. Opt, for example, for competitive commissions or bonuses.

Working with specialized agencies

Calling on an agency with expertise in e-commerce or affiliate marketing can simplify the integration and management of your program. With over 10 years’ experience in affiliate marketing, Casaneo puts its expertise at your service. Our experts are on hand to help you optimize your campaigns. With their knowledge of emerging trends and technologies, they enable advertisers to stay competitive while reducing the complexity of online operations.

Maximize your performance and revenue with Casaneo. Make an appointment today.

Key steps to successfully integrating an affiliation platform

Choosing the right affiliation platform will enable your e-commerce business to increase its visibility and sales, and build solid relationships with its affiliate partners. Here are the key steps to maximizing the performance of your affiliate program.

Analyze and select the right platform for your e-commerce business

To make the right choice among affiliate platforms, you need to assess your needs by asking yourself the right questions: what type of product do you offer? Who are your target customers? Are you looking for platforms with the right features, such as simplified payment management and a large network of high-performance affiliates?

Do you operate in specific sectors such as fashion and homeware? Casaneo is the platform to help your sales take off! With our network of over 3,800 affiliates, you have access to qualified professionals who know your niche inside out.

Ensure smooth technical implementation through effective onboarding

Well-executed onboarding guarantees the success of your integration. Configure your site with advanced tracking tools to record every sale generated by your affiliates. Ensure that commission policies, payment deadlines and performance criteria are clearly defined. At Casaneo, we offer technical support and comprehensive documentation to help every advertiser get up and running quickly.

Optimize performance with high-performance analysis tools

To maximize your results, adopt a data-driven approach. Modern affiliate platforms offer comprehensive dashboards for tracking conversions, traffic and commission rates in real time.

With Casaneo, it’s easy to identify the best-performing affiliates and optimize your campaigns by providing them with the right marketing materials. By analyzing the data, you can adjust your strategies and guarantee continued growth for your network.

Overcoming common obstacles in affiliate programs

Like any digital marketing strategy, affiliate programs also face challenges. Challenges do indeed remain, particularly when it comes to acquisition costs and effective conversion tracking. That’s why we insist on choosing the right affiliate platform. It must provide robust, automated performance tracking tools.

This gives you precise data on the sale, the product sold and the affiliate responsible. Commission payments are also made correctly. Real-time conversion tracking allows you to adjust strategies to increase performance and guarantee long-term results.

 

In 2025, affiliation platforms are profoundly transforming business strategies. They offer a flexible, measurable and profitable solution for marketers and e-commerce managers. Now you can reach new audiences, optimize ROI and capitalize on emerging trends.

To optimize your strategy, discover Casaneo’s innovative solutions today.

Key ideas

  • In 2025, affiliate marketing platforms will redefine business strategies by automating complex processes and maximizing revenues through targeted partnerships.
  • These platforms offer tools for managing affiliate programs, tracking affiliate performance and ensuring simplified commission payments.
  • Affiliation reduces advertising costs by replacing costly campaigns with performance-based collaborations. The result is higher sales and lower expenses.
  • Emerging technologies, such as AI and automation, optimize affiliate strategies, improve management and performance analysis.
  • Preparing your e-commerce site for affiliation means choosing the right platform, defining a clear strategy and working with experts to maximize performance.
  • Casaneo offers a network of specialized affiliates to help e-tailers penetrate new markets and expand their online presence.

 

Contact one of our Casaneo experts

If you'd like to be put in touch with our experts, tell us more about your project...

* The information on this form is required but optional. Once we have collected this data, we will contact you to discuss your issues and needs. In accordance with the French Data Protection Act of January 6, 1978, as amended, you have the right to access and rectify any information concerning you. If you wish to exercise this right and obtain information about yourself, please contact contact@casaneo.io.